Preventing Physical and Psychological Complications
Substance misuse can lead to serious physical consequences if left untreated. Liver damage, cardiovascular strain, and neurological changes may develop over time.
Through structured Drug Recovery in Faerie Glen, Pretoria, ARC Addiction Recovery Centre offers medical supervision when necessary. Early care reduces the likelihood of severe withdrawal complications and long-term health risks.
Additionally, early intervention helps stabilise mood disorders, anxiety, and trauma-related symptoms before they intensify.
Interrupting Harmful Behavioural Patterns
Addiction strengthens behavioural habits over time. The longer substance use continues, the more ingrained these patterns become.
At ARC Addiction Recovery Centre, Drug Recovery in Faerie Glen, Pretoria focuses on disrupting these patterns early. Through Cognitive Behavioural Therapy and structured counselling, clients identify triggers and learn healthier coping mechanisms.
Addressing these behaviours promptly reduces the risk of relapse in the future.
